I was a long-term user of coconut oil. It's not that big of a deal... No magic product can "strengthen" your hair . However the GREAT thing about any oil is its properties to make hair softer after hairwashes. Try applying some oil before you shampoo your hair. Coconut is a good oil to use for this.

And it does add some shine. The trick is to use only a little bit for a leave-in "shine treatment", maybe one or two drops only. rub it between your palms and stroke your palms down the length of hair.

   You got it... coconut oil is good.. used it some... But i love Extra Virgin Olive Oil.. But you got to make sure its NOT just olive oil.. cause the Extra Virgin is the frist pressing of the olives..

  I put it in my hair at night,, I put some in my hand and rub them together and then spread it in.. and also make sure i get it on the ends.. and then in the morning wash it out before i got to work...      it also makes for a good hot oil treatment.. heat it up some and then put it in your hair and wrap it up for awhile..and then wash it out... and also if you go to the beach or spend time in the sun in the summer.. put some in and sit out in the sun...
